Republicans in the US push for Harris to reveal VP pick : Analysis

Reading Time (200 word/minute): 2 minutes

US Republicans have stated that debating Kamala Harris would be unfair to her eventual running mate until the Democrats decide on their ticket. This comes amidst calls for President Joe Biden to withdraw from the race. The Republican campaign emphasized the need to wait for the Democratic nominee before locking in a debate date. Speculations about Biden’s potential replacement have circulated, with California Governor Gavin Newsom, Illinois Governor JB Pritzker, and Michigan Governor Gretchen Whitmer being mentioned. Meanwhile, Harris has proposed debate dates as Democrats gear up for their convention in August.
